    Hi Eagle
    The dagger is original Third Reich Army ( Heer )

    The time period appears correct for the grip , scabbard and pommel being used around the 1936 time period with the grip being a mid period type.

    The only detail I see that does not appear to be consistent with a Luneschloss type is the crossguard being a late period FW Holler type 4 ( 1940 time frame ) I would say obviously it did not come out of the factory that way and may have been added at a later date or post war.

    Gerrit or Dr73 will be able to pinpoint further exact details of the crossguard and dagger. Overall It is authentic .

    First please make decent pictures, the pommel isnt visisble.
    This Pack type 3 crossguard has widely been used by a lot of small producers that didnt designed their own guards, but so far i havent seen any on Luneschloss.
    Is it imposible on a Luneschloss? no its not, but we need to see good detailed pictures of the pommel to see if that a Pack product too.

    For know i tend to look at it as a partsdaggers

    Ger


    Larry sorry my friend, its not a Höller type 4 ( look for the big punced eye, wavepattern on the brest and the alu material), besides that the timeframe of the Pack 3 starts as early as late 1936 - early 1937, as i have seen plenty of them having early tapered tangs and early maker marks on the blades they were found on.
